As the battle between the rupee and the dollar continued, gold prices in Pakistani jewellery markets saw yet another significant increase on Monday.
24-karat gold has gone up by Rs. 950 per tola in price.
The cost of 24-karat gold increased to Rs188,150 per tola as a result.
A 10-gram piece of 24-karat gold now costs Rs161,308, an increase of Rs814.
The cost of a 10-gram piece of 22-carat gold also rose, reaching Rs147,866.
A tola of 24-karat pure silver now costs Rs2,100, an increase of Rs20.
To reach Rs1800.41, the cost of 10 grammes of 24-karat silver increased by Rs17.15.
